Rain takes over Times Square
A billboard of Rain’s new film "Ninja Assassin" has been hung in New York’s Times Square, making him the first Korean to appear on the board for a movie, according to his agency.
Only Korean companies such as Samsung or LG have been able to advertise themselves in Times Square before.
J.Tune Entertainment said that the billboard — almost 18 meters wide by 12 meters high — was hung above smaller billboards for some of Broadway’s most famed musicals including "West Side Story" and "Chicago".
The agency said they were informed of the billboard by a Korean residing in New York and received many congratulatory messages on his blog and website.
The film is scheduled to be released on November 25, 2009.
